1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does 'feasible' mean?
Back
Capable of being done or achieved; possible.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Define 'consternation'.
Back
A state of anxiety or dismay, typically at something unexpected.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the meaning of 'perfunctory'?
Back
Carried out with a minimum of effort or reflection; done as a routine duty.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does 'affluent' refer to?
Back
Having a great deal of money; wealthy.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Define 'discern'.
Back
To perceive or recognize something; to distinguish.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does 'sally' mean in a literary context?
Back
A sudden charge or leap forward; a witty or lively remark.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the meaning of 'precocious'?
Back
Having developed certain abilities or proclivities at an earlier age than usual.
